Games That Actually Get Played

The game library is where Kachingo earns its keep. Hundreds of slots from NetEnt, Play’n GO, Pragmatic Play, and others. You get the classics – Starburst, Book of Dead – alongside newer Megaways titles. Table game players aren’t ignored either: multiple blackjack and roulette variants sit alongside baccarat and poker. The live dealer section is powered by Evolution Gaming, which is the gold standard. Real croupiers, HD streams, and games like Lightning Roulette and Crazy Time keep things lively.

Here’s a quick breakdown of what you can expect across the main categories:

Category Examples Typical RTP Range
Slots Starburst, Gonzo’s Quest, Book of Dead 94% – 97%
Table Games European Roulette, Blackjack Classic, Baccarat Pro 97% – 99.5%
Live Dealer Live Blackjack, Lightning Roulette, Crazy Time 94% – 99%

That range matters. If you’re playing blackjack at 99.5% RTP with basic strategy, the house edge is tiny. Kachingo doesn’t hide these numbers – they’re easy to find in the game info panels.

Bonuses That Don’t Insult Your Intelligence

The welcome bonus is generous without being ridiculous. You get a match deposit plus free spins on selected slots. The wagering requirements are standard for the UK market – around 35x to 40x on the bonus amount, which is fair. But the real value is in the ongoing offers. Reload bonuses, free spins on new releases, and a VIP programme that actually rewards loyalty rather than just asking for bigger deposits.

Here are the key things to know before you claim anything:

  • Minimum deposit is low enough for casual players – usually £10 or £20.
  • Game contributions vary: slots count 100%, table games often count less than 20%.
  • Max bet while playing with bonus funds is typically £5 per spin.
  • Bonus validity is usually 30 days – don’t let it expire.

Is It Secure? Yeah, It Is

Legitimate question. Kachingo operates under a UK Gambling Commission licence. That means regular audits, mandatory responsible gambling tools (deposit limits, reality checks, self-exclusion), and strict anti-money laundering checks. The site uses SSL encryption, and account verification is required before any withdrawal – which is a pain but proves they’re following the rules.
